Fried Goat Cheese When Pregnant . Goat cheese is a good source of protein, calcium, and essential vitamins, which benefit the parent and the developing baby. Pasteurized cheese of any variety is considered safe during pregnancy, except for those that have surface ripening. Hard cheese contains less moisture than soft cheese, which slashes the. Which cheese is best when pregnant? Pregnant women may consume goat cheese as long as it is made from pasteurized milk and does not have a white coating or rind on the outside. Pasteurization is the process of killing bacteria, yeast, and mold found in raw milk. If goat cheese is one of your favorite cheese products, you will be glad to know that it is safe for pregnant women to consume as long as you follow certain food safety guidelines.
